الوصف: Background Guided endodontics have high accuracy and are successful techniques that had been gradually used in endodontics in recent years. However, the guided bur produces excessive heat during continuous rotation and friction with root canal walls. It is not clear whether the degree of temperature increase may lead to periodontal ligament and alveolar bone damage. Methods Forty single-rooted premolars were scanned using CBCT and intra-oral scanner, and 3D-printed guided plates were made with the pre-designed access. A custom-made guided bur was used to prepare the access cavities. The postoperative CBCT data and pre-designed pathways were matched to evaluate the deviation between planned and virtual path. Another 18 single-rooted premolars were accessed with the guided plates and bur, ET20 and ProTaper F3, respectively. The temperature changes on the root surfaces were inspected with a thermocouple thermometer. Results The average deviation on the tip and the base of the bur were 0.30 mm and 0.28 mm (mesial/distal), and 0.28 mm and 0.25 mm (buccal/lingual). The average angle deviation was 3.62°.
